Mahavatar Narsimha (Hindi) fetches Rs 4 crore on Day 19, Tuesday discount offer brings delight
Bankrolled under the banners of Hombale Films and Kleem Productions, Mahavatar Narsimha added Rs 4 crore to its net business on the 19th day at the Hindi box office. The growth was because of the discount offer on Tuesday, which facilitated the audience to book their tickets at cheaper prices.
It comes after the blockbuster animated movie earned Rs 3 crore net on Day 18. The third weekend collection of the mythological action film stood at Rs 34 crore.
The Ashwin Kumar directorial debuted with a total collection of Rs 29 crore in the first week. It then minted Rs 50 crore net in the second week of its release. Within 19 days, Ashwin Kumar's film fetched Rs 120 crore in the Hindi markets.
The collections exclude 3D handling charges
An overview of Mahavatar Narsimha's phenomenal performance
Mahavatar Narsimha's stunning animations, strong word-of-mouth, and deep-rooted emotional connection with the audience are some of the factors for its blockbuster success in the market. The Hindi version of the film has been the biggest contributor to its achievements.
It has outperformed Dhadak 2 and Son of Sardaar 2 in the Hindi markets. The devotional actioner now has to compete with War 2 and Coolie, which will arrive on August 14, coinciding with the Independence Day weekend. Going by its stronghold, we might get to see a tough battle between them.

Raj Kundra offers kidney to Premanand Maharaj, gets trolled: ‘Strange world we live in'
Amid Rs 60 crore fraud allegations, actor Shilpa Shetty and her husband, Raj Kundra, visited spiritual leader Premanand Maharaj in Vrindavan. A video of their visit was shared online on the guru's official channels. In the video, Raj offers one of his kidneys to the guru, whose own two kidneys are compromised. His statement quickly went viral, with many calling it a PR stunt. Premanand Maharaj also counts actor Anushka Sharma and cricketer Virat Kohli as his disciples. In a video shared by the YouTube channel Bhajan Marg, Raj Kundra can be heard saying, 'I have been following you since the past two years. You have been all over social media. When I was coming here, I was constantly thinking 'What do I question him?' And whatever questions appeared in my head, you would answer them through Instagram. Today's youth and the entire society has been following you. Your teachings are so helpful. Right now, I have no questions to ask. But, I do know that you have a failed kidney since the past two decades, I just want to say if I can ever be a help to you then I want to donate a kidney of mine to you.' Premanand replied with a laugh, 'Please, no. You stay healthy and happy… that's all I want. By God's grace, I am doing just fine.' ALSO READ | Malaika Arora says people 'pointed fingers' at her, called her 'selfish' after divorce from Arbaaz Khan: 'Co-parenting isn't easy' Raj Kundra's offering, however, was labeled a PR move. After severe backlash, Raj took to his social media handles to share a note addressing his trolls. He wrote, 'Strange world we live in when someone chooses to offer a part of themselves to save another's life, it's mocked as a PR stunt. If compassion is a stunt, may the world see more of it. If humanity is a strategy, may more people adopt it. I'm not defined by labels the media or trolls throw at me. My past does not cancel my present choices, and my present intentions are not for you to measure with your cynicism.' He concluded his note with the line, 'Judge less, love more you might just save a life too.' This, too, received backlash with many trolling him for his current association with Rs 60 crore fraud. It is reported that Raj and Shilpa have defrauded a Mumbai-based businessman for nearly Rs 61 crore. However, in a statement, the couple called the allegations 'baseless and malicious.'
